A Winter Experience Like no Other in the World. The Montréal en Lumière Festival Opens a 1000-Foot-Long Aerial Skating Trail with an Ambience of Immersive Sound and Light
Montréal en Lumière
The innovative concept: Original and designed with Montreal’s winter-loving spirit in mind, the Skating Loop inspires citizens to return to downtown Montreal and reclaim space vacated after the pandemic. A play of illuminated installations, exciting musical atmosphere, constant heated comfort and optimal skating experience in an urban environment—challenge met, hands down!

All the senses are engaged during the Skating Loop experience. On the elevated structure poised 2.5 meters above the ground, skaters are treated to a breathtaking view of the urban panorama, enhanced by large-scale video projections on the facades of surrounding structures, the Wilder Building and UQAM President Kennedy Pavilion. Hundreds of LED tube lights add extra enchantment to this icy course, while a state-of-the-art sound system broadcasts a playlist compiled just for the event throughout the site.
